A simple and healthy spinach salad with a tangy vinaigrette.
Preparation time: 15 Minutes
Cooking time: 5 Minutes
Total duration: 20 Minutes
Calories: 200, Fat: 15g, Protein: 10g, Carbs: 5g
This classic spinach salad is perfect for a quick lunch or a side dish. The salad is made with fresh spinach leaves, crispy bacon, and boiled eggs, all tossed in a tangy vinaigrette. It's easy to make, packed with nutrients, and absolutely delicious.
Wash and dry the spinach leaves.
Fry the bacon until crispy and chop into pieces.
Slice the hard-boiled eggs and the red onion.
In a small bowl, whisk together the olive oil, red wine vinegar, Dijon mustard, salt, and pepper to make the vinaigrette.
Combine the spinach, bacon, eggs, and onion in a large bowl.
Pour the vinaigrette over the salad and toss to combine.
